View full detailsThe strongest picks are open-ended and hands-on — magnetic tiles, construction sets, marble runs, strategy games and STEM kits. They stretch reading, numbers, logic and creativity through play, and because there's no single right answer, they keep challenging school-age children as they grow.
Magnetic tiles, marble runs, building and construction sets, and simple coding or circuit toys all suit five and six year olds. They turn geometry, physics, cause-and-effect and logical thinking into hands-on play, building genuine STEM skills without it feeling like schoolwork.
Well-chosen educational toys grow reading, numbers, logic, spatial reasoning and problem-solving, plus the focus and persistence school demands. Open-ended designs let children discover concepts themselves, which sticks better than rote learning and suits how five and six year olds like to play.
Hands-on, screen-free toys put a child in charge of the thinking, building deeper skills, creativity and social play than most electronic toys. Blocks, games and STEM kits are used in many ways and invite others to join, offering richer learning than a screen.
Match the toy to your child's interests and aim just above their current skill, so it's challenging but achievable. Favour open-ended toys and games that grow with them. A few versatile, absorbing pieces beat a shelf of single-purpose gadgets for a school-age child.
